In Germany, a local authority called the Strassenverkehrsamt (or Fuhrerscheinstelle) issues the driver's license. This office can be located in a city hall, county courthouse, or municipal building. The process is relatively straightforward, though it may take several weeks. The first step is to make an appointment. You'll need your current ID and license along with an passport-style photo.

The next step is passing both a written and a practical driving test. The written test is comprised of multiple choice questions, and also includes a short essay. The practical test is more difficult as you will be asked to perform a variety of maneuvers. To pass, you'll need to be able to respond correctly to all situations and adhere to strict traffic rules.

If you pass both the written and practical exams If you pass both, you'll be issued a temporary permit. This permits you to drive legally while your German driver's licence arrives in the post it could take up to six weeks. During this period, you must practice with friends or family who have a valid driver's license.

How do I switch my driving license from another country for the German driving license?

When you move to Germany and wish to continue driving, you must change your license from abroad to one German one. This process is called 'Umschreibung einer auslandischen Fahrerlaubnis' (exchange of an abroad driver's licence). However, a good place to start is at your local driving license office (Fuhrerscheinstelle), which can usually be found in your city's government building or town hall.

You will need to submit the following documents in general:

The documents can differ from the country to the other, but in most cases you will need to provide a photocopy your driving license, passport, and proof of identification. In certain instances you might also be asked to provide a translation of your driving license into German, if necessary.
